Connecting an Optional Serial EEPROM
The ATR0625P offers the possibility to connect an external serial EEPROM. The internal ROM
firmware supports to store the configuration of the ATR0625P in serial EEPROM. The pin
P16/NEEPROM signals the firmware that a serial EEPROM is connected with the ATR0625P.
The 32-bit RISC processor of the ATR0625P accesses the external memory with SPI (Serial
Peripheral Interface). Atmel recommend to use 32 Kbit 1.8V serial EEPROM, e.g. the Atmel
AT25320AY1-1.8. Figure 3-3 shows an example of the serial EEPROM connection.

Note: The GPSMODE pin configuration feature can be disabled, because the configuration can be
stored in the serial EEPROM. VDDIO is the supply voltage for the pins: P23, P24, P25 and P29.
